AS-101, also designated SA-6, was the sixth flight of the Saturn I launch vehicle and the first to carry a boilerplate Apollo spacecraft. It launched from Cape Kennedy Air Force Station on the 28th of May 1964.
What was the boilerplate spacecraft BP-13 used on AS-101?
BP-13 was a dummy Apollo spacecraft that duplicated the size and shape of the real command and service module but weighed 17,000 pounds, roughly 5,000 pounds more than a flight-weight command module. It was instrumented with 116 sensors measuring strain, pressure, temperature, heat flux, and acceleration.
What engine failure occurred during the AS-101 flight?
Engine number eight shut down at 116.9 seconds after liftoff when the teeth on a turbopump gear were stripped off. The rocket's guidance system compensated by burning the remaining seven engines for 2.7 seconds longer than planned.
How many orbits did AS-101 complete and where did it reenter?
AS-101 completed 54 orbits in total. The spacecraft reentered the atmosphere east of Kanton Island in the Pacific Ocean on the 1st of June 1964.
Why did AS-101 require three launch attempts?
The first attempt was scrubbed after liquid oxygen damaged a wire mesh screen, causing fuel contamination. The second was scrubbed when an air conditioning compressor failure caused the guidance system to overheat. On the third attempt, a theodolite was obscured by liquid oxygen vapors, but engineers reprogrammed the computer to proceed without the reading.
What was the purpose of AS-101 in the Apollo program?
AS-101 was designed to verify the launch aerodynamics of the Apollo command and service module and its launch escape system tower. It was followed by four more Saturn I flights for the same purpose before NASA progressed to crewed vehicles.
